About Dr Salim Maher
Dr Salim Maher is a Gastroenterologist and Hepatologist with an interest in advanced liver disease & cirrhosis, gastrointestinal endoscopy & colonoscopy, and irritable/inflammatory bowel conditions.
He graduated from the University of Sydney Medical School and completed his specialist training at St George and Sutherland Hospitals. He subsequently undertook a Fellowship in liver failure & liver transplantation at Royal Prince Alfred Hospital.
He is a Staff Specialist at Royal North Shore Hospital and Visiting Medical Officer at St George Private Hospital and Waratah Private Hospital.
He is currently conducting his PhD on the interplay between diet’s effect on the gut microbiome and the development/progression of liver disease at the University of New Wales, in addition to teaching and supervision of medical students and junior medical doctors.
